PUNE, Sept 22: Although experienced, IM Abhijit Kunte eagerly awaits representing the country at the Olympiad.``I have been a regular in several tournaments abroad. But playing at the Olympiad has its own taste,'' says Abhijit. The Olympiad has fond memories for Abhijit and his family where sister Mrunalini won her IWM title in 1996. The 22-year-old has had a hectic time in recent months -- playing in Poland, Switzerland and Russia -- but the will to play has kept him going.
The final GM norm has eluded him but Abhijit has temporarily set aside the idea. ``I am only concentrating on the Olympiad preparation.'' More so because he knows what made him lose 35 valuable Elo points. ``I concentrated too much. As a result I committed too many silly mistakes''.
Mohan Phadke has come out in a big way helping Abhijit with vital tips. ``I have been analysing the games along with Phadke. I do not want to repeat the mistakes.'' Abhijit will be accompanied by Dibyendu Barua, Pravin Thipsay, V Sarvanand, K Sasikiran and Anup Deshmukh. For Abhijit, Sasikiran, Sarvanand and Deshmukh, it will be the first feel of the Olympiad.
Abhijit still feels that a preparatory camp before the Olympiad for all those selected would have helped them understand each other better and fine tune co-ordination.
